973 William Avenue – Property Summary

Key Characteristics & Buyer Profile

This is a compact, older home on Winnipeg’s William Avenue, built in 1907. Its living area is 688 square feet—well below the street, neighbourhood, and city averages. The assessed value ($99,000) is also low relative to comparable properties, ranking near the bottom on every level. The land area (3,299 sqft) is close to the middle of the pack for the street and neighbourhood, though still below the citywide average.

The property’s main appeal is its price point. For buyers who want to own a detached home in the city without stretching their budget, this is about as affordable as it gets. The combination of a very low assessed value and a small living area suggests it could suit someone looking for a starter home, a renovation project, or a low-cost entry into the market in a central neighbourhood. It’s less suited for families needing space or buyers who want a property that already matches area norms for size or finish.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Does the low assessed value mean the house is in poor condition?
Not necessarily. Assessed value reflects market comparisons for similar homes, but it can also be influenced by small living area, age, or limited recent sales data. It’s worth getting a home inspection to separate condition from the numbers.

2. How does the 1907 build year affect insurance or maintenance?
Homes from that era often have older wiring, plumbing, and foundations. Some insurers charge higher premiums or require updated systems. It’s a good idea to check with an insurance broker before committing.

3. Is a 688 sqft house practical for daily living?
It depends on your lifestyle. With efficient layout, it works for a single person or a couple. But storage, entertaining, and room for guests will be limited. The lot is just over 3,200 sqft, so there’s some outdoor space but not much room to expand the footprint.

4. Why is the land area ranked higher than the living area?
This property has a land area that’s much closer to its neighbourhood average than its living area is. In older parts of Winnipeg, small houses on modest lots are common. The land holds a fair share of the property’s value, especially for redevelopment or future additions.

5. What kind of neighbourhood is West Alexander?
West Alexander is an older, centrally located area with a mix of residential and light commercial uses. It’s walkable to some amenities, but not a high-end or newly developed pocket. Buyers should consider noise, proximity to main roads, and the general condition of surrounding properties when viewing.
